I sent Pallaso mobile money for transport after his concert — Roden Y Kabako

Team No Sleep singer Roden Y Kabako allegedly admitted that his Sitani Tonkema concert and Pallaso’s Soma concert were indeed not well attended. According to Howwe.biz, he allegedly bragged  that he made “some money” despite the low turn out and came to the aid of his arch-rival whom he claimed had a worse night.

“Our concerts flopped so I decided to send him 80k on his mobile money for transport back home. I made some money compared to him,” Howwe.biz reported. He allegedly made the statements at Zzina Fest over the weekend.

The two artistes held parallel concerts last Friday with Roden Y at Laftaz and Pallaso at Kyadondo grounds.
